Using Botox to Prevent Migraines

Woman with a migraineThough Botox is mainly known for its ability to reduce wrinkles on the face, it also can act as a treatment for chronic migraines. Researchers have discovered that those who suffer from chronic migraines that also receive Botox injections reported having fewer migraines than they did before. Though it is currently unknown how these injections are reducing the frequency, future studies are in the works.

Botox for migraines is injected into the muscles around the bridge of the nose, temples, forehead, nape of the neck, and upper back. The procedure can burn, but only takes about ten to fifteen minutes to complete. When used as preventative medicine, Botox in Cary, NC, requires treatment every twelve weeks for maximum effectiveness.

There are some potential side effects to receiving Botox injections, such as neck pain, muscle weakness, injection site pain, and a rise in blood pressure. Some more severe side effects include dizziness, eyelid swelling, jaw pain, and difficulty swallowing. However, many of the more severe effects are also very uncommon.

Can Diabetics Have Plastic Surgery?

Woman before and after cosmetic surgeryPeople with diabetes may be concerned with undergoing plastic surgery, as there are increased risks for healing complications post-procedure. However, cosmetic surgery in Durham, NC is possible for people with diabetes who can have tight control of their blood glucose levels.

If a person with diabetes is interested in cosmetic plastic surgery, a surgeon will determine if they have adequate control over their blood glucose levels to move forward with the procedure. This involves a hemoglobin A1C test, which will assess how well the patient’s blood glucose levels were controlled over the past two or three months. If this level is less than7%, then they can be cleared for the procedure.

Surgery can also affect how the body responds to insulin, so the plastic surgeon will need to work with the diabetic’s primary doctor through the course of the procedure and recovery time. It is essential that they work out any medication details, as they may need to be temporarily adjusted immediately after the surgery.

Plastic surgeons will commonly operate on people with diabetes, so long as the correct precautions are made throughout the procedures. Important Questions to Ask Your Plastic Surgeon

Surgeon and staff during a procedure

If you are interested in any plastic surgery, it is incredibly important to research on your own before visiting the first doctor that comes up in your searches. When searching for a plastic surgeon, there are a few important questions you should be asking them before you start talking details about your surgery.

  1. Are they Board Certified?

Searching for board-certified plastic surgeons in NC is essential to ensure your potential doctor’s commitment to excellence within the field. Certification by The American Board of Plastic Surgery will show that your surgeon has completed specialized training for their line of work.

  1. How often have they Performed the Procedure?

When you are planning to have cosmetic or reconstructive surgery, you want to ensure that your surgeon is very experienced at the procedure you are looking for. No one wants to be someone’s first, second, or even 50th patient on a particular procedure. The more experience your surgeon has, the less likely you will experience complications.

  1. Will Other Medical Staff assist with the Surgery?

It is very important for you to be aware of the people that will be in the room during your procedure. Be sure to ask your surgeon who will be part of their support team and their qualifications. It is also good to know if there will be any emergency staff on hand or if there will be any medical students or interns involved.


Can You Be Immune to Botox?

Woman lying on field of dandelionsBotox in Cary, NC is one of the most popular cosmetic procedures. Unfortunately, it does not work for everyone, and it is possible that your body may be immune to the injections. Though Botox comes with a variety of potential side effects, what can you do if it just doesn’t work?

Some patients may have success with their first few treatments, but over time develops immunity to the injections. Others appear to have no success after just the first treatment. Botox resistance can be frustrating, and the fact that some people can become resistant at all is not well known. Before this immunity was discovered, it was assumed that the product was not working due to improper storage or an error with the injection process. This resulted in many women spending a significant amount of money on a product that their body will unknowingly not accept.

Though the number of those who resist Botox is low, it is important to know that there is a chance these injections will not work. If you receive a treatment and don’t experience any effects that you were hoping to, talk to your doctor to help determine if your body is immune.

Cosmetic Nose Surgery for Men

Handsome young manMore and more men are beginning to opt for cosmetic surgery in Durham, NC and it is important to know all of the necessary information, as the procedure, recovery time, and side effects differ between men and women.

Rhinoplasty can be performed on women from age 13 on, but men must wait until they are 15 to go through with this procedure. This is because women stop growing before men do and they need those extra few years to ensure that all of their bone structures have matured and fused.

Like women, many men find themselves self-conscious about the shape or size of their nose and consider surgery to alter their appearance. Below is the procedure for basic cosmetic nose surgery.

  • Depending on personal preference and the extent of the surgery, a rhinoplasty can be done under general or local anesthetic.
  • An open rhinoplasty is where an incision is made between the nostrils so internal structures can be accessed with ease. The patient may experience more swelling with this type of surgery
  • A closed rhinoplasty does not require an incision and tends to have quicker recovery times.
  • All incisions made during the procedure are done in a way that will minimize scarring and are commonly done inside the rim of the nostrils.
  • Operation time takes between one and two hours.

How to Prepare for a Plastic Surgery Consultation

plastic surgery north carolinaDeciding to undergo plastic surgery is a life-changing event. By scheduling a consultation with your cosmetic surgeon, you are one step closer to achieving your ideal look. Before you go to your consultation, you will need to prepare. Here is a quick guide to help you get the most out of your consultation for plastic surgery in North Carolina.

Define Your Goals

You have scheduled a consultation with your surgeon, so chances are you have a clear idea of what you want from your procedure. Take the time to write out exactly what you are looking for from this specific procedure as well as your “Big Picture” goal. Making sketches or finding photographs online will also be helpful. The more accurately you can define your goals, the better your surgeon will understand and be able to help you accomplish your goals. Pay close attention during the consult – does your surgeon appear to be on the same page?

Research Your Desired Procedure

It is always best to do your homework before your consultation. Reading up on the specific procedure you desire will help you ask the right questions during the consultation. It will also make it easier to understand what your surgeon has to say about your specific procedure.

 

Wear Clothing that Can Easily Be Removed

If you are looking to get breast or body surgery, it is important to wear clothing that is easy to remove. Your surgeon may want to perform an examination to help them determine exactly what they can do for you. A button up shirt is best when getting a consultation for breast augmentation.

 

Organize your Medical History

Make a list of your current medications and a report of your health history so that the doctor will be better able to plan your procedure. The surgeon needs to be aware of any potential problems that may arise during and after the procedure.

Three Things You Didn’t Know About Botox

botox cary ncFor many people, Botox is a fountain of youth – a way to smooth out wrinkles and keep you looking younger, longer. As a non-surgical procedure with few risks, Botox is an attractive option for those unwilling to go under the knife to achieve their ideal face. While most people are aware of this product and what it does, you may not know these three interesting facts about Botox:

You Don’t Have to Be Old

In fact, Botox works best when you start early. Most people see Botox as a way to reverse the effects of aging, but it is most effective when you use it as a preventative measure. Stopping wrinkles before they have a chance to really set in on your face will keep you looking young much longer than if you begin receiving injections after you start seeing significant wrinkles.

Botox isn’t Only for Wrinkles

In addition to keeping wrinkles at bay, Botox also as many non-cosmetic applications. Patients see amazing, and sometimes life-changing results when they receive Botox for conditions like excessive underarm sweating, migraines, overactive bladder, chronic pain lockjaw, and plantar fasciitis (heel pain).

You Can Extend the Life of Your Injections

To work, Botox uses enzymes, which in turn rely on Zinc to form. Taking a zinc supplement for several days before your Botox procedure and after can prolong the effectiveness of your injections. While Botox usually lasts around three months, you may extend that timeframe with the use of Zinc.

What to Know Going into an Abdominoplasty

Woman relaxing on the beachAn abdominoplasty is a fantastic way to get rid of excess skin and fat around the stomach. Though a tummy tuck sounds like the ultimate solution for many, it is a surgical procedure and comes with recovery times, scars, and sometimes complications. Before you go under the knife, below are a few things you should know before your abdominoplasty.

Plan for Recovery: The average recovery time for an abdominoplasty is at least two weeks. It is essential to prepare ahead of time for your recovery so you can rest, keep up with housework, and find child-care assistance if necessary.

Eat Well for Faster Healing: Before your surgery, prepare your kitchen with healthy, nutritious foods to eat during the recovery process. The healthier you eat, the faster your recovery may be as a diet full of grains, lean protein, and vegetables improve your immunity.

Prepare for a Scar: As with any surgery, a tummy tuck will also result in a scar across your abdomen. Though the appearance will fade with time, this scar may never entirely go away. Fortunately, the incision is made low enough that it is easy to hide for most patients.

Top 3 Reasons Women Get Breast Augmentations

Woman in white lace bra holding flowersBreast augmentation surgery can be beneficial to many women, both medically and cosmetically. As one of the most common plastic surgeries in the country, women all over are choosing to undergo this procedure. When it comes to “why?” the reasons are endless, but here are the top three reasons why women opt for a breast augmentation in Cary, NC.

  1. Boost Self-Esteem

One of the main reasons why women undergo breast augmentation is to boost their self-esteem. Whether they are unhappy with the shape, size, or any other aspect, many women believe changing their appearance through surgery will help them gain the confidence they have been lacking. Breast augmentation can help breasts look proportionate, perky, and give women the fuller figure they desire.

  1. Weight Loss or Pregnancy

Another reason women might opt for breast augmentation is if they recently lost weight and their breasts no longer have a full, perky shape. This surgery allows them to have a fuller chest while maintaining the slimmer waistline and healthy weight they have achieved. Pregnancy can also cause a woman’s chest to droop, and breast augmentation helps them achieve their pre-baby body once again.

  1. Reconstruct After a Mastectomy

Women who have had a mastectomy due to breast cancer or other health conditions will find that breast reconstruction surgery allows them to regain a full figure. Not only does it include an implant, but also skin grafting and nipple/areola construction for a realistic appearance.
